WebJan 31, 2024 · Read the Law: Md. Code, Courts and Judicial Proceedings, § 5-101 However, some types of cases have a different limitation period, by law. For example, the limitation period for assault, libel, or slander is one year. Read the Law: Md. Code, Courts and Judicial Proceedings, § 5-105 WebArticle - Courts and Judicial Proceedings § 5-522. WebIn smaller Maryland cases, there is a backdoor that attorneys - and victims handling their own case - can use under Maryland Courts and Judicial Proceedings Code § 10-104 that allows the introduction of medical bills and records - in District or Circuit Court - without the need for expert testimony as long as the claim is under $30,000.
